Kirsty MacLean is a 21-year-old football player who plays as a attacking midfielder for Liverpool, born on April 12, 2005. Follow Kirsty MacLean on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2025/2026 WSL season, Kirsty MacLean has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 743 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.57.

Kirsty MacLean's career has also included time at Rangers.

On the international stage, Kirsty MacLean has represented Scotland, Scotland Under 19, and Scotland Under 17.
